Output 54fdb5a3b0a8ab2a035b4b3db430b81bc17cd4f19abc30bf5b77410ce9c34e47:6

value
129633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7db6bb565a632440dd4a42e0627677afd140598d OP_EQUAL
address
3D9jHx2uNEwTQq7cDscoXJZa3zgLVE6BUr
transaction
54fdb5a3b0a8ab2a035b4b3db430b81bc17cd4f19abc30bf5b77410ce9c34e47